In: Economics 8 Answers ActiveNewestOldest Anonymous Posted April 4, 2021 0 Comments Stock price depends on number of shares issued to determine the value of the company. A company with few shares will likely have a high stock price, but may still be of lower value. You are viewing 1 out of 8 answers, click here to view all answers. Register or Login
